Source code is the list of human readable instructions that a programmer writes when developing a program. The source code is run through a compler to turn it into machine code, also called object code that a computer can unerstand and execute.

If the need arises, you can request the source code from the escrow agent. They’ll check if the conditions for release are met, like the provider going out of business.
In Cincinnati, a trusted third-party escrow agent manages the agreement. They’re like the referee, ensuring everything runs fair and square for all parties involved.
The main perks include peace of mind knowing your software will always be available, protection against vendor failure, and assurance that you can continue your operations smoothly.
Having a Source Code Escrow in Cincinnati is smart if you rely on specific software. It ensures you have a backup plan if the software company shuts down or stops supporting it.
A Source Code Escrow Agreement is like a safety net for software. It means that the code behind the software is held in trust by a third party, so you can access it if something goes wrong with the provider.
